목록전체 글 (27)
chanyong's notepad
- Knowledge graph[https://metawriters.tistory.com/m/41](https://metawriters.tistory.com/m/41)지식 그래프는 실제 엔터티와 해당 관계를 나타내는 데이터 구조입니다. 노드와 에지로 구성되어 웹과 같은 구조를 만듭니다. 이 구조는 기존의 관계형 데이터베이스와 비교할 때 보다 직관적이고 유연한 쿼리 및 정보 표시를 허용합니다. 지식 그래프의 주요 목적은 포괄적이고 의미론적으로 풍부한 정보 표현을 제공하는 것입니다. 이 정보는 정형 및 비정형 데이터를 비롯한 다양한 소스에서 가져올 수 있으며 자연어 처리, 추천 시스템 및 질문 응답 시스템을 비롯한 광범위한 애플리케이션을 처리하는 데 사용할 수 있습니다.- KG 생성[https://taej..

부팅 이후 ip를 설정할 시 변경되어 외부에서 접속이 불가능한 경우가 생겼습니다.이때 ServerApp.ip 주소에 사설 ip를 할당하여 해당 문제가 발생했음을 확인하였습니다. 이는 공인 ip:포트번호를 입력 시 사설 ip로 연결되도록 포트포워딩하여 해결할 수 있습니다. 1. 포트포워딩저의 경우, 데스크탑의 랜선을 kt 공유기에 연결하고, 해당 공유기에서의 공인 IP와 특정 포트를 통해 접근하면, 사설 IP의 특정 포트로 연결시켜주도록 구현할 것입니다.kt 공유기의 경우, 아래 주소로 접속하면 아래와 같은 화면이 나오게 됩니다. GIGA WiFi home 주소 : http://172.30.1.254초기 아이디 : ktuser, 비밀번호 : homehub 여기에서 로그인해주신 뒤, 공인 IP를 확인해줍니..
터미널에서 firefox를 설치하려고 할 때 snap 사용을 강제하나, 한글 입력이나 실행 속도의 문제가 발생합니다.따라서 본 글에서는 기존의 apt를 이용해서 설치하는 방법을 서술합니다. 1. 터미널에서 firefox 설치버전에 맞게 둘 중 하나를 선택하여 터미널에 입력해주시면 됩니다.이때 저의 경우 snap 삭제 과정에서 read-only file system 에러가 발생했는데, 이는 아래 글을 참조해주시면 감사하겠습니다.https://bny9164.tistory.com/36 리눅스(LINUX) 파일 권한 변경 시 Read-only file system 에러 처리개인 서버를 오랜만에 접속해서 특정 파일을 실행하려고 하니 원래 정상적으로 실행되던 파일이 아래와 같이 에러가 발생했습니다. 이건 리눅스 시..

Emote는 Linux를 위한 이모지 제공 프로그램으로, 단축키는 Ctrl+Alt+E입니다.위 단축키를 입력하면 이모지 화면이 뜨고, 거기에서 이모지를 클릭함으로써 이모지를 사용할 수 있습니다.🙂 아래는 github에서의 소개글입니다. Emote is a modern emoji picker for Linux 🚀. Written in GTK3, Emote is lightweight and stays out of your way.Launch the emoji picker with the configurable keyboard shortcut Ctrl+Alt+E, and select one or more emojis to have them be automatically pasted into your cur..

Ubuntu와 같이 linux를 사용하는 운영체제에서 스크린샷을 찍고자 할때, PrintScreen key가 없어 당혹스러운 경우가 발생할 수 있습니다.예를 들어, logitech 키보드에는 해당 key가 존재하지 않습니다. Windows/Mac의 경우 각각 "CMD|alt" + "camera icon" / "cmd" + "shift" + "4" 키를 입력하는 방식으로 해결할 수 있으나, linux의 경우 작동하지 않음을 확인할 수 있습니다.이에 관한 해결 방법을 서술하겠습니다. 1. 터미널을 이용하여 스크린샷 찍기Ubuntu와 같은 운영 체제에서 즉시 캡처하기 위해 터미널을 열고 다음을 입력합니다.gnome-screenshot 캡처를 지연하려는 경우 "D"( "지연"의 경우)와 지연 초를 나타내는 숫자..

macOS 기반 VSCode에서의 C/C++ 분할 컴파일 방법에 대해 서술하겠습니다. 아시다시피, mac에서는 Visual Studio로 바로 C++ 프로그램을 실행시키기 어려운 만큼, VSCode를 활용하게 됩니다.VSCode는 에디터에 불과한 만큼 추가적인 확장 프로그램 ..
보호되어 있는 글입니다.

0. Backgroundchatgpt와 같은 딥러닝 모델은 아래와 같은 한계점을 지니고 있습니다.1. 정보 접근 제한 2. 토큰 제한 3. 환각 현상 이들을 해결하기 위해 아래와 같은 학습 기법들이 활용됩니다.1. Fine-tuning : 기존 딥러닝 모델의 weight를 조정하여 원하는 용도의 모델로 업데이트2. N-shot learning : 0~n개의 출력 예시를 제시하여 딥러닝이 용도에 알맞은 출력을 하도록 조정3. In-context learning : 문맥을 제시하고, 이 문맥 기반으로 모델이 출력하도록 조정1. In-context Learning(ICL) 문맥을 제시하고, 이 문맥 기반으로 모델이 출력하도록 조정하는 학습 방법입니다.zero-shot learning, few-shot lea..